Transaction 6921cc3766065ddd25590321ad9ed4e097744eece557737b96c1157a59009253

1 Input
2 Outputs
  • 6921cc3766065ddd25590321ad9ed4e097744eece557737b96c1157a59009253:0
  • value  10000000
    address  3MRC5Xw44HSUzQP1sNmP9xxJJCyvHPnJLA
  • 6921cc3766065ddd25590321ad9ed4e097744eece557737b96c1157a59009253:1
  • value  1757083
    address  bc1qtmnmfps627glxjhfyk3ymt22lf499qpa49v8ec